Overview

ANTXR like pseudogene 1 (ANTXRLP1) is a human genomic sequence classified as a pseudogene, meaning it resembles a functional gene (in this case, likely related to the anthrax toxin receptor/ANTXR family) but contains disabling mutations such as frameshifts or stop codons that prevent it from encoding a functional protein. No evidence currently suggests it has an active biological function or clinical relevance as a biomarker or therapeutic target. Some pseudogenes are transcribed and may have regulatory RNA functions; however, there is no specific evidence for such a role for ANTXRLP1.
